WebAt a broad level, history tells us the relative returns and risks for the three main investment types are: Highest for stocks. Intermediate for bonds. Lowest for cash. For cash, the nominal annualized return since 1928 has been about 3.3% as measured by historical rates from 3-month Treasury bills.
